#include "i965_test_fixture.h"
const std::string I965TestFixture::getFullTestName() const
{
const ::testing::TestInfo * const info =
::testing::UnitTest::GetInstance()->current_test_info();
return std::string(info->test_case_name())
+ std::string(".")
+ std::string(info->name());
}
Surfaces I965TestFixture::createSurfaces(int w, int h, int format, size_t count,
const SurfaceAttribs& attributes)
{
Surfaces surfaces(count, VA_INVALID_ID);
if (attributes.empty()) {
EXPECT_STATUS(
i965_CreateSurfaces(
*this, w, h, format, surfaces.size(), surfaces.data()));
} else {
VADriverContextP ctx(*this);
EXPECT_PTR(ctx);
if (ctx) {
EXPECT_STATUS(
ctx->vtable->vaCreateSurfaces2(
*this, format, w, h, surfaces.data(), surfaces.size(),
const_cast<VASurfaceAttrib*>(attributes.data()),
attributes.size()));
}
}
for (size_t i(0); i < count; ++i) {
EXPECT_ID(surfaces[i]);
}
return surfaces;
}
void I965TestFixture::destroySurfaces(Surfaces& surfaces)
{
EXPECT_STATUS(
i965_DestroySurfaces(*this, surfaces.data(), surfaces.size()));
}
VAConfigID I965TestFixture::createConfig(
VAProfile profile, VAEntrypoint entrypoint, const ConfigAttribs& attribs,
const VAStatus expect)
{
VAConfigID id = VA_INVALID_ID;
EXPECT_STATUS_EQ(
expect,
i965_CreateConfig(
*this, profile, entrypoint,
const_cast<VAConfigAttrib*>(attribs.data()), attribs.size(), &id));
if (expect == VA_STATUS_SUCCESS) {
EXPECT_ID(id);
} else {
EXPECT_INVALID_ID(id);
}
return id;
}
void I965TestFixture::destroyConfig(VAConfigID id)
{
EXPECT_STATUS(i965_DestroyConfig(*this, id));
}
VAContextID I965TestFixture::createContext(
VAConfigID config, int w, int h, int flags, const Surfaces& targets)
{
VAContextID id = VA_INVALID_ID;
EXPECT_STATUS(
i965_CreateContext(
*this, config, w, h, flags,
const_cast<VASurfaceID*>(targets.data()), targets.size(), &id));
EXPECT_ID(id);
return id;
}
void I965TestFixture::destroyContext(VAContextID id)
{
EXPECT_STATUS(i965_DestroyContext(*this, id));
}
VABufferID I965TestFixture::createBuffer(
VAContextID context, VABufferType type,
unsigned size, unsigned num, const void *data)
{
VABufferID id;
EXPECT_STATUS(
i965_CreateBuffer(*this, context, type, size, num, (void*)data, &id));
EXPECT_ID(id);
return id;
}
void I965TestFixture::beginPicture(VAContextID context, VASurfaceID target)
{
EXPECT_STATUS(
i965_BeginPicture(*this, context, target));
}
void I965TestFixture::renderPicture(
VAContextID context, VABufferID *bufs, int num_bufs)
{
EXPECT_STATUS(
i965_RenderPicture(*this, context, bufs, num_bufs));
}
void I965TestFixture::endPicture(VAContextID context)
{
EXPECT_STATUS(
i965_EndPicture(*this, context));
}
void I965TestFixture::destroyBuffer(VABufferID id)
{
EXPECT_STATUS(
i965_DestroyBuffer(*this, id));
}
void I965TestFixture::deriveImage(VASurfaceID surface, VAImage &image)
{
EXPECT_STATUS(
i965_DeriveImage(*this, surface, &image));
}
void I965TestFixture::destroyImage(VAImage &image)
{
EXPECT_STATUS(
i965_DestroyImage(*this, image.image_id));
}
void I965TestFixture::syncSurface(VASurfaceID surface)
{
EXPECT_STATUS(
i965_SyncSurface(*this, surface));
}
